- BEVERLY HILLS, Calif. (AP) -- Country sweetheart Faith Hill received four American Music Award nominations Monday, leading a pack of artists vying for awards chosen by fans.









Marc Anthony and the rock band Creed received three nominations, while Toni Braxton, Destiny's Child, Celine Dion, Eminem, Alan Jackson, 'N Sync, Sisqo and Britney Spears got two each.









The nominees are chosen by music industry data, but the winners are selected by a national sampling of approximately 20,000 listeners. The awards will be presented Jan. 8 at the Shrine Auditorium in Los Angeles in a three-hour show broadcast by ABC.









Spears will be the host of the 28th annual show.









The nominees:









POP/ROCK




MALE ARTIST: Marc Anthony, Eminem, Kid Rock.




FEMALE ARTIST: Christina Aguilera, Celine Dion, Faith Hill, Britney Spears.




BAND, DUO OR GROUP: Backstreet Boys, Creed, 'N Sync.




ALBUM: "Human Clay," Creed; "No Strings Attached," 'N Sync; "Ooops! ... I Did It Again," Britney Spears.




NEW ARTIST: Macy Gray, Jessica Simpson, 3 Doors Down.









SOUL/RHYTHM & BLUES




MALE ARTIST: D'Angelo, Brian McKnight, Sisqo.




FEMALE ARTIST: Toni Braxton, Whitney Houston, Kelly Price.




BAND, DUO OR GROUP: Destiny's Child, Jagged Edge, Lucy Pearl.




ALBUM: "Heat," Toni Braxton; "The Writing's on the Wall," Destiny's Child; "Unleash the Dragon," Sisqo.




NEW ARTIST: Donnell Jones, Mary Mary, Pink.









COUNTRY




MALE ARTIST: Alan Jackson, Tim McGraw, George Strait.




FEMALE ARTIST: Faith Hill, Martina McBride, Reba McEntire.




BAND, DUO OR GROUP: Brooks & Dunn, Dixie Chicks, Lone Star.




ALBUM: "Breathe," Faith Hill; "Under the Influence," Alan Jackson; "How Do You Like Me Now," Toby Keith.



NEW ARTIST: Alecia Elliott, Billy Gilman, Keith Urban.





ADULT CONTEMPORARY




ARTIST: Marc Anthony, Celine Dion, Faith Hill.









LATIN MUSIC




ARTIST: Marc Anthony, Enrique Iglesias, Shakira.









RAP/HIP HOP




ARTIST: DMX, Dr. Dre, Eminem.









ALTERNATIVE MUSIC




ARTIST: Creed, Limp Bizkit, Red Hot Chili Peppers.









SOUNDTRACK




"Coyote Ugly," "Mission Impossible 2," "Nutty Professor 2."
